5y+3x=10
5y= -3x+10
/5
y= -3x/5 +2..............1

3y-5x=6  
3y=5x+6
/3
y=5x/3+2

You find that the slopes of these two lines are negative reciprocal of each other. m1*m2=-1

3	x	+	5	y	=	10	.............1	
-5	x	+	3	y	=	6	.............2	
Eliminate y								
multiply (1)by 		-3						
Multiply (2) by		5						
-9x-15y=-30		
-25x+15y=30		
Add the two equations								
-34x=0		
/-34							
x=0		
plug value of x	in (1)				
3x+5y=10		
5y=10		
5	y	=	10
5	y	=	10		
y	=	2   

They intersect at (0,2)
